Golf Carts That Look Like Cars:

Introduction: This section highlights the key features that distinguish golf carts that look like cars from their traditional counterparts, emphasizing their distinct design and appeal.

Key Aspects:

  • Exterior Design: Sleek lines, bold styling, and modern touches that mimic the aesthetic of luxury cars.
  • Customization: Wide range of options for personalization, including paint colors, wheels, and accessories.
  • Advanced Features: Powerful engines, extended range batteries, and innovative technology like GPS, Bluetooth, and audio systems.

Discussion: The automotive influence on these carts is evident in their design. From the sculpted hoods and sleek windshields to the integrated headlights and taillights, the exterior mirrors the aesthetics of contemporary cars. These carts are often built on a custom chassis, allowing for greater flexibility in creating unique designs. The ability to personalize these vehicles through paint jobs, decals, and aftermarket parts makes them a canvas for individual expression, catering to a diverse range of preferences.

Street Legality:

Introduction: This section focuses on the legal aspects of driving golf carts that look like cars on public roads, emphasizing the varying regulations and requirements across different jurisdictions.

Facets:

Roles:

  • Governmental Regulation: State and local governments set the rules for street legality, including licensing, registration, and insurance requirements.
  • Manufacturers: Collaborate with authorities to ensure vehicles meet legal standards and offer street-legal modifications when applicable.

Examples:

  • LTV (Low-Speed Vehicle): A classification defined by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), allowing golf carts with specific features to be operated on public roads.
  • Street-Legal Conversion Kits: Available for some traditional golf carts, enabling them to meet legal requirements for street use.

Risks and Mitigations:

  • Safety Concerns: Golf carts that look like cars can be perceived as regular vehicles, potentially leading to confusion and accidents.
  • Mitigation: Clear signage, visible safety features, and driver education can help prevent confusion and promote safety.

Impacts and Implications:

  • Growing Market: The demand for street-legal golf carts is rising, prompting manufacturers and governments to develop clearer regulations and safety guidelines.
  • Accessibility and Convenience: Street-legal golf carts can offer an alternative mode of transportation, particularly for short-distance travel and in areas with limited parking.

Summary: The legal landscape surrounding golf carts that look like cars is complex and evolving. It is crucial to understand the specific regulations in your area to ensure safe and legal operation of these vehicles.

Performance and Features:

Introduction: This section focuses on the technological advancements that enhance the performance and features of golf carts that look like cars, highlighting their ability to deliver a more powerful and enjoyable driving experience.

Further Analysis: Modern golf carts that look like cars often boast impressive performance capabilities, incorporating advanced features found in traditional automobiles.

Closing: The evolution of these carts has seen a significant emphasis on performance, features, and technology, making them a compelling option for those seeking a blend of style and functionality.

Feature Details
Engine Powerful electric or gas-powered engines with higher torque and speed for improved acceleration and hill climbing.
Range Advanced battery technology extends the driving range, allowing for longer trips without needing to recharge.
Suspension Improved suspension systems provide a smoother and more comfortable ride, even on uneven terrain.
Technology Integrated GPS navigation, Bluetooth connectivity, audio systems, and other technological advancements enhance convenience and entertainment.
